Detailsinfo

A vulnerability, which was classified as problematic, has been found in IBM WebSphere Service Registry and Repository (Application Server Software). This issue affects an unknown functionality.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a cross site scripting vulnerability. Using CWE to declare the problem leads to CWE-79. The product does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es user-controllable input before it is placed in output that is used as a web page that is served to other users. Impacted is integrity. The summary by CVE is:

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in the widgets in IBM WebSphere Service Registry and Repository (WSRR) 7.5.x before 7.5.0.4 and 8.0.x before 8.0.0.3 allows remote authenticated users to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via unspecified vectors.

The weakness was released 12/24/2014 (Website). The advisory is shared at xforce.iss.net. The identification of this vulnerability is CVE-2014-6178 since 09/02/2014. The attack may be initiated remotely. The successful exploitation needs a simple authentication. It demands that the victim is doing some kind of user interaction. Neither technical details nor an exploit are publicly available. MITRE ATT&CK project uses the attack technique T1059.007 for this issue.

The vulnerability scanner Nessus provides a plugin with the ID 80857 (IBM WebSphere Service Registry and Repository 7.5 < 7.5.0.4 Multiple Vulnerabilities), which helps to determine the existence of the flaw in a target environment. It is assigned to the family Windows.

Upgrading to version 8.0 eliminates this vulnerability.

The vulnerability is also documented in the databases at X-Force (98514), Tenable (80857), SecurityFocus (BID 71907†) and Vulnerability Center (SBV-48450†).
